#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<errno.h>
#include <netinet/in.h>
#include <sys/socket.h>
#include <arpa/inet.h>
#include <sys/epoll.h>
#include <unistd.h>
#include <sys/types.h>
#define IPADDRESS "127.0.0.1"
#define PORT 6666
#define MAXSIZE 1024
#define LISTENQ 5
#define FDSIZE 1000
#define EPOLLEVENTS 100
/*函数声明*/
/*创建套接字并进行绑定*/
int socket_bind(const char* ip,int port);
/*IO多路复用epoll*/
void do_epoll(int listenfd);
/*事件处理函数*/
void handle_events(int epollfd,struct epoll_event *events,int num,int listenfd,char *buf);
/*处理接收到的连接*/
void handle_accpet(int epollfd,int listenfd);
/*读处理*/
void do_read(int epollfd,int fd,char *buf);
/*写处理*/
void do_write(int epollfd,int fd,char *buf);
/*添加事件*/
void add_event(int epollfd,int fd,int state);
/*修改事件*/
void modify_event(int epollfd,int fd,int state);
/*删除事件*/
void delete_event(int epollfd,int fd,int state);
int main(int argc,char *argv[]){
int listenfd;
listenfd = socket_bind(IPADDRESS,PORT);
listen(listenfd,LISTENQ);
do_epoll(listenfd);
return 0;
}
int socket_bind(const char* ip,int port){
int listenfd;
struct sockaddr_in servaddr;
listenfd = socket(AF_INET,SOCK_STREAM,0);
if (listenfd == -1){
perror("socket error:");
exit(1);
}
bzero(&servaddr,sizeof(servaddr));
servaddr.sin_family = AF_INET;
inet_pton(AF_INET,ip,&servaddr.sin_addr);
servaddr.sin_port = htons(port);
if (bind(listenfd,(struct sockaddr*)&servaddr,sizeof(servaddr)) == -1){
perror("bind error: ");
exit(1);
}
return listenfd;
}
void do_epoll(int listenfd){
int epollfd;
struct epoll_event events[EPOLLEVENTS];
int ret;
char buf[MAXSIZE];
memset(buf,0,MAXSIZE);
/*创建一个描述符*/
epollfd = epoll_create(FDSIZE);
/*添加监听描述符事件*/
add_event(epollfd,listenfd,EPOLLIN);
while(1){
/*获取已经准备好的描述符事件*/
ret = epoll_wait(epollfd,events,EPOLLEVENTS,-1);
handle_events(epollfd,events,ret,listenfd,buf);
}
close(epollfd);
}
void handle_events(int epollfd,struct epoll_event *events,int num,int listenfd,char *buf){
int i;
int fd;
/*进行选好遍历*/
for (i = 0;i < num;i++){
fd = events[i].data.fd;
/*根据描述符的类型和事件类型进行处理*/
if ((fd == listenfd) &&(events[i].events & EPOLLIN))
handle_accpet(epollfd,listenfd);
else if (events[i].events & EPOLLIN)
do_read(epollfd,fd,buf);
else if (events[i].events & EPOLLOUT)
do_write(epollfd,fd,buf);
}
}
void handle_accpet(int epollfd,int listenfd){
int clifd;
struct sockaddr_in cliaddr;
socklen_t cliaddrlen;
clifd = accept(listenfd,(struct sockaddr*)&cliaddr,&cliaddrlen);
if (clifd == -1)
perror("accpet error:");
else{
printf("accept a new client: %s:%d\n",inet_ntoa(cliaddr.sin_addr),cliaddr.sin_port);
/*添加一个客户描述符和事件*/
add_event(epollfd,clifd,EPOLLIN);
}
}
void do_read(int epollfd,int fd,char *buf){
int nread;
nread = read(fd,buf,MAXSIZE);
if (nread == -1){
perror("read error:");
close(fd);
delete_event(epollfd,fd,EPOLLIN);
}
else if (nread == 0){
fprintf(stderr,"client close.\n");
close(fd);
delete_event(epollfd,fd,EPOLLIN);
}
else{
printf("read message is : %s",buf);
/*修改描述符对应的事件,由读改为写*/
modify_event(epollfd,fd,EPOLLOUT);
}
}
void do_write(int epollfd,int fd,char *buf){
int nwrite;
nwrite = write(fd,buf,strlen(buf));
if (nwrite == -1){
perror("write error:");
close(fd);
delete_event(epollfd,fd,EPOLLOUT);
}
else
modify_event(epollfd,fd,EPOLLIN);
memset(buf,0,MAXSIZE);
}
void add_event(int epollfd,int fd,int state){
struct epoll_event ev;
ev.events = state;
ev.data.fd = fd;
epoll_ctl(epollfd,EPOLL_CTL_ADD,fd,&ev);
}
void delete_event(int epollfd,int fd,int state){
struct epoll_event ev;
ev.events = state;
ev.data.fd = fd;
epoll_ctl(epollfd,EPOLL_CTL_DEL,fd,&ev);
}
void modify_event(int epollfd,int fd,int state){
struct epoll_event ev;
ev.events = state;
ev.data.fd = fd;
epoll_ctl(epollfd,EPOLL_CTL_MOD,fd,&ev);
}
